IT Operations Manager
Permanent
Leeds/ Hybrid working
To lead the IT Operations team including IT Infrastructure Services and IT Network Services to deliver operationally effective Infrastructure and Network services to all regional operating companies, construction and sales sites. Operational service to be delivered against agreed SLA’s (Performance KPI’s and budget).
For IT Infrastructure Services accountable for delivering operational stable infrastructure services, developing a clear roadmap to meet the growing needs of the business and delivering against this plan to maintain infrastructure stability in line with agreed SLA’s.
For IT Network Services accountable for delivering world class IT Network Management services. Including day to day operational performance of network to agreed SLAs and KPIs and changes to the network that meet ongoing and growing business demands.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
* Design, develop and grow the new IT Operations operating model, recruiting, growing and developing the team (new and old team members).
* Demonstrates strong stakeholder management skills with the IT leadership team
* Develop the strategic roadmap for IT Operations, aligned to the overall IT Operations and Cyber strategy that gives clear direction to the team. Working with the senior IT team to develop this strategy.
* Design and develop the new IT Operations team operating model which will provide excellent Infrastructure and Network services. Support direct reports in developing their operating models and recruitment and growth of their teams, including development of processes and procedures.
* Develop improvement plans as part of the strategy, delegate responsibility and track delivery against this plan.
Infrastructure Services
* Accountable for the effective operation of IT Infrastructure Services, including the Server Environment, Infrastructure and End User Experience. Ensuring that operational services are delivered to agreed SLA’s, where service does not meet these levels put in place remedial action to correct.
* Ensure all systems have appropriate cyber security controls in place that restrict both internal and external threats.
* Ensure all system logs are available for ingestion in to Security Operations Centre (SOC), when in place.
* Work closely with third-party supplier to deliver the datacentre strategy and move service in to BAU. Ensure that appropriate monitoring is in place and that third-party activity is effectively and robustly managed/monitored.
* Working with IT Service Delivery Manager, deliver effective future capacity planning to ensure that growth in IT usage is appropriately planned and budgeted.
Network Services
* Accountable for the development of the network technology strategy, gaining agreement to this. Design, plan and deliver against this plan.
* Provide senior point of interface and accountability for all aspects of network service delivery and assurance.
* Ensure the stable running of the network environment and it’s monitoring in collaboration with suppliers.
* Ensure the network is cyber secure and tested on a regular basis. Ensure network meets all internal/external network security standards.
* Overall accountability for lifecycle management of the network service from provisioning, upgrades to decommissioning.
* Ensure a comprehensive understanding and documented library of the IT network, standards, procedures and policies are maintained.
QUALIFICATIONS
* A Level IT, BTEC in Computing or equivalent.
* MCP, MCSA, MCSE or equivalent.
* CompTIA Network+, CCNA, CCNP or equivalent.
* Technical qualifications: E.g. Appropriate Microsoft certifications across technical areas of role responsibility such as Server, Exchange, Azure etc.
* ITIL - V3/V4 Foundation.
